Dual-Output 100 VDC Plastic Relay
Part No. LPBD100
The LPBD100 is a dual-output 100 Vdc plastic relay. The relay output-switch contacts are normally closed and will conduct the load current until a voltage is applied to the relay input. With 4 volts or more at the relay input, the output-switch contacts open and the relay no longer conducts. The LPBD100 assembly contains two independent, completely isolated relays.MSL 6 Available options include:LPBD100 0.25Adc, 100Vdc Load; 4-7Vdc Control;

Relays & Switches - InP-Die
The InPD1012 series is a wideband, reflective, SPDT Active RF Switch Die, manufactured using Teledyne’s high-speed, low-loss InP HEMT process. With bandwidths from DC to 60GHz, and signal integrity up to and above 40Gbps, this switch die is ideal for integration into test and measurement equipment, microwave communications, and radar applications. The InPD1012 can tolerate up to 100 krads of radiation, alowing it to be used in space applications as well.

Coaxial Multi-Throw Switches
What is the difference between Failsafe and Latching?Failsafe switches are Normally Open; when a position is energized, the Open contacts will Close, until voltage is removed. It will then revert back to the Normally Open position. These are commonly used in applications where a default known state is required.Latching switches will remain in the last energized position until the next position is energized. It is commonly used in applications where power consumption is critical or limited.
